Since graduating in Drama from the University of Bristol last year, Emma has been involved in numerous creative projects in film production and community-driven arts, as well as marketing for Oxfam festivals.She has a passion for interdisciplinary work, which is reflected in her devised production,…We are proud to present the inaugural Limina VR Weekender, an opportunity to discover a range of world-class, artistic VR experiences right here at Watershed. The weekender has been curated by Pervasive Media Studio residents Catherine Allen and Emma Hughes and coincides with the launch of their new VR company Limina Immersive.
From cutting edge dance, to a VR wildlife safari, to a trip through a surrealist painting, this weekend of immersive experiences will open your senses to an emerging new world of creative potential.
